What You Will Do
This role is part of the Income Tax group within Tax Operations. Key responsibilities of the role could include:
Assist with gathering and analyzing data, performing computations, and preparing work papers for tax returns, provisions, forecasts and projects
Assisting with the preparation of federal, state and/or Canadian corporate income tax estimates, extensions and returns for a diverse group of businesses conducting multi-national operations
Collaborating with tax, business and accounting partners to obtain data necessary for tax calculations and reporting
Identifying tax process enhancements and automation opportunities
Acting as an embedded team member within Disney’s Corporate Tax Center of Excellence (COE)
Drafting user manuals for the department to outline Standard Operating Guidelines
